In this episode we discuss the 2020-2021 Sportsman access program season. We talk about the harvests this season and the trends we noticed. We talk about how the current world situation may have effected those trends. We also discuss the upcoming management plans for SAP properties and give some insight on where you may want to be on opening day of turkey season 2021.
